1. A reciprocating pump having a power end and a fluid end, the pump comprising:
a pinion shaft assembly disposed in the power end, the pinion shaft assembly comprising:
a tubular member having an inner bore, first and second ends, and at least one bearing surface positioned adjacent the first end of the tubular member, the at least one bearing surface configured to receive at least one roller bearing;
a bearing shoulder positioned adjacent the at least one bearing surface of the tubular member;
a first pinion gear member having an interference coupling extension having an outside shape corresponding to an inside shape of the first end of the tubular member to achieve a tight friction fit therebetween such that rotation between the first pinion gear member and the tubular member is substantially prevented when the interference coupling extension is inserted within the first end of the tubular member; and
a second pinion gear member having an interference coupling extension having an outside shape corresponding to an inside shape of the second end of the tubular member to achieve a tight friction fit therebetween such that rotation between the second pinion gear member and the tubular member is substantially prevented when the interference coupling extension is inserted within the second end of the tubular member,
wherein the bearing shoulder has an outside diameter greater than an outside diameter of the at least one bearing surface and is configured to prevent movement of a bearing away from the first pinion gear member.
